1. A method for ensuring authenticity of written and printed documents, the method comprising:

  • depositing electronic ink onto a document, wherein the electronic ink deposited comprises at least one mark visible to a user;

    applying a current to the electronic ink while the electronic ink is wet, wherein the current is used to imprint a pattern in the electronic ink, and wherein the pattern is adapted for use in verifying the authenticity of the document; and

    allowing the electronic ink deposited on the document to dry.
